We are looking for a Content Lead, who is passionate about gaming and it’s gaming community.

This role will lead the mission of exploring different kinds of projects and exercising his/hers creativity along the way.

Our ideal candidate thrills to communicate with our players and community and loves to create and explore new ideas and rationals.

Job Description

  • Lead the video content production through creating, scripting and directing projects
  • Provide new inputs and ideas of content for our products in alignment with our branding strategy
  • Conceptualize and develop new video series for our channels alongside with the creative team, and overview the writing of scripts for each show
  • Produce, shoot and edit high-quality videos in a wide range of styles
  • Planning and coordinating a team for: recording of video content, interpreting scripts, conducting rehearsals, directing activities of cast and technical crew for recording
  • Build and manage a team of video editors
  • Carry consistency throughout entire projects, ensuring the highest quality for all assets produced
  • Work with on-camera talent and other production staff to craft ideas into engaging & repeatable series and one-off videos
  • Work with the digital content team to develop and maintain a long-term editorial and promotional calendar
  • Devise unique, creative ideas for new video features, content and enhancements that advance objectives and strategic plan
  • Be the owner creative vision and shape content from pre-production to delivery
  • Support and encourage feedback, team discussions, and foster an environment of safe and productive iteration;
  • Manage the development of the video staff through training, mentorship, and personal growth;
  • Create and maintain production schedules of delivery, aligning with other team leaders.

Job Requirements

  • A minimum of 2+ years of experience in audiovisual for the entertainment industry;
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Cloud, After Effects, DaVinci Resolve, Final Cut Pro and/or Adobe Premiere
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, social networking platforms, Google Analytics, or similar tools
  • Knowledge of video recording and directing for Cinema/TV and Internet
  • Knowledge of various correlated areas such as photography direction, production, art direction, assistant direction, etc;
  • Professional experience establishing creative vision and strategy;
  • Ability to learn new systems quickly
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Experience leading/mentoring individuals. Growth minded and motivated towards teaching, enabling, and coaching other professionals;
  • Ability to work quickly and efficiently, delivering high quality results under the pressure of deadlines, with routinely quick turnaround times
  • Proven exceptional management skills
  • Excellent time management and prioritization skills with strong attention to detail and high work standards
  • Experience with project management tools such as Trello, Monday, or similar
  • Flexibility; able to shift gears quickly
  • Ability to work collaboratively with a team, independently, and under close direction
  • Experience creating videos for platforms including Facebook, YouTube and, Instagram
  • Track record of creating video that grows and engages social audiences organically
  • Background in studio and field production
